I have no complaints with Chops. We had good quality steaks and good service.

 

Wonderland? They're trying too hard to be hip. So they bring you this blank piece of paper as your menu and have you put water on it with a paintbrush to make the menu appear. I don't see the point in them bringing out the menu when the server proceeds to tell you that HE will be making the decisions for you tonight, then he proceeds to bring out a bunch of stuff that we wouldn't have ordered had we been given the chance. Half of our starters were duds because they were made of things we don't like to eat. The other half were duds because they were more about presentation than taste. The main course got better, and dessert was great. Meanwhile, people on both sides of us who had been there before, were given the option to order what they wanted because they knew the menu. This pissed me off. If you're on a dining package, if you repeat this restaurant they charge you a fee. And if you're not on a package, you have to shell out $70 for a party of two before you can come back for the chance to pay to order what you want? GTFO with your pretentious self, Wonderland. If you're going to hand me a menu and make a big deal over "discovering" what's on it, let me order from it.
